"You know nothing, Jon Snow."

The famous Game of Thrones catchphrase, first uttered by the wildling warrior Ygritte and subsequently adopted by the show's legion of fans, cannot be paraphrased and tossed in the direction of Joe Errington, a marketing executive and self-professed expert on the HBO fantasy series. As it turns out, he knows a lot.

Errington competed on a recent episode of the British quiz show Mastermind, which tasks contestants with answering two rounds of questions — one based on general knowledge, and another on a specific subject of the contestant's choosing.

In Errington's case, he chose George R.R. Martin's A Song of Ice and Fire, the novel series that Thrones is based on, as his subject of choice, and was tasked with answering a series of incredibly difficult and specific questions about the world of Westeros — questions that casual viewers of the show, and even many die-hard readers of the books, would have trouble mastering.
